On any federal land in SC you can only off-road on approved jeep trails. (The Francis Marion forrest has a couple, but they flat and mostly dry). I'm in Charleston not Myrtle so i'm not sure what's up that way unfortunately.

As far as jeep shops, there is a club in Charleston called "LowCountry Jeep Club" and some of the guys in the club are licensed dealers for some 4x4 products. If you google "LowCountry Jeep Club" you can post what you are looking to do when you are here and see if anybody from there can help you out. It's only 2 hours from Myrtle.
